Dr. Harry M. Rhea is an Assistant Professor of Criminal Justice in the School of International and Public Affairs and an Assistant Professor of Law in the College of Law at Florida International University (FIU). He co-developed FIU's nation-leading international criminal justice Ph.D. program. His expertise spans international criminal law, criminal justice systems, and interdisciplinary legal frameworks.
Dr. Rhea holds a Ph.D. in International Criminal Law from the National University of Ireland, Galway (2012), an M.A. in Theology from LaSalle University, and an M.S. in Criminal Justice with a specialization in Law Enforcement Intelligence and Crime Analysis from Saint Joseph's University.
He teaches ISS 6219: International Law and focuses on research areas including transnational crime, legal policy, and the intersection of law and global security. His academic contributions emphasize building bridges between criminal justice and international legal systems.
